How much do lifeguard man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for lifeguard manager in Decatur, GA is $19.83,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.81 and $22.31 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a lifeguard manager?

A Lifeguard Manager is responsible for overseeing lifeguard staff, ensuring water safety, and maintaining emergency response protocols at aquatic facilities. They supervise hiring, training, and scheduling of lifeguards while enforcing safety regulations. Additionally, they inspect equipment, handle incidents, and communicate with facility management to ensure a safe environment for patrons and staff.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a lifeguard manager?

To thrive as a Lifeguard Manager, you should have strong leadership abilities, experience in aquatic safety, and typically hold certifications in lifeguard training and CPR/AED instruction. Familiarity with pool management software, scheduling tools, and emergency response protocols is also important. Excellent communication, conflict resolution, and team-building skills help you effectively supervise staff and interact with patrons. These skills and qualifications ensure a safe aquatic environment, smooth operations, and high team morale.

How much do lifeguard managers make?

Lifeguard managers typically earn between $30,000 and $50,000 annually, depending on experience, location, and the size of the facility. They are responsible for overseeing lifeguard staff, ensuring safety protocols, and managing schedules, often requiring certifications in lifeguarding and first aid.

What are some common challenges faced by lifeguard managers, and how can they be addressed?

Lifeguard Managers often face challenges such as maintaining consistent safety standards, managing staff scheduling, and responding to emergencies or conflicts among team members. Proactive communication and regular training sessions help keep lifeguard teams prepared and engaged. Balancing administrative duties with on-deck supervision is another common challenge, making strong organizational skills essential. By fostering a culture of accountability and support, Lifeguard Managers can create a safe, efficient, and positive environment for both staff and patrons.

What do lifeguard managers do?

Lifeguard managers oversee the operations of lifeguard staff at pools, beaches, or aquatic facilities, ensuring safety protocols are followed and emergency procedures are in place. They coordinate schedules, train staff, enforce rules, and handle incident reports to maintain a safe environment. Strong leadership, communication skills, and certifications in lifeguarding and first aid are essential for this role.

Where do lifeguard managers make the most money?

Lifeguard managers tend to earn higher salaries in regions with a high cost of living and in upscale or private aquatic facilities. Factors such as experience, certifications, and the size of the facility also influence earning potential, with larger or more prestigious venues offering higher pay. Generally, urban areas and popular tourist destinations provide the highest compensation for lifeguard managers.

We’re hiring a Vehicle Service Technician (VST) responsible for ensuring our ambulances are effectively serviced, safe and ready for response. This is a key role to help our team maintain and deliver timely and high-quality transportation services, care and customer service to patients. 

Responsibilities: 

  • Vehicle Service Technicians will ensure the ambulances are fully stocked, safely maintenance and ready to provide transportation services. 
  • Take pride in maintaining a safe and clean vehicle environment for the crew and the patients. 
  • Manage daily vehicle inventory checks to ensure stock of supplies and equipment, regularly update the equipment tracking log and place replacement requests when necessary. 
  • Run regular mechanical checks including oil, washer fluid and batteries, and report any vehicle issues to the Fleet Manager as needed. 
  • Clearly document information as required and adhere to company policies and procedures while complying with the company’s information security standards. 
  • Use appropriate communication methods to help facilitate coordination of efforts between departments crews and other vehicle service techs. 
  • Work collaboratively and in a professional manner with all allied health and public safety personnel as well as your fellow VSTs and operations team.
